NAME
       al_ustr_replace_range - Allegro 5 API

SYNOPSIS
	      #include <allegro5/allegro.h>

	      bool al_ustr_replace_range(ALLEGRO_USTR *us1, int start_pos1, int end_pos1,
		 const ALLEGRO_USTR *us2)

DESCRIPTION
       Replace	the part of us1 in the byte interval [start_pos, end_pos) with
       the contents of us2.  start_pos cannot be less than 0.  If start_pos is
       past  the  end  of us1 then the space between the end of the string and
       start_pos will be padded with NUL ('') bytes.

       Use al_ustr_offset(3) to find the byte offsets.

       Returns true on success, false on error.
